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79748490910 330 68 45758 7991164
72741 488171050
72741 488171050
49222823930 595927 457785
All about undefined
Interested in learning more?
72741 488171050
49222823930 595927 457785
See more
609075 02990530
595 3933534 354 5185821
See more
6291215506 3668795
1628 99548839 3504879 50546757557
See more